- Title
Oxidative stress and non-enzymatic glycation in IgA nephropathy.
- Authors
Vas, T; Wagner, Z; Jenei, V; Varga, Z; Kovács, T; Wittmann, I; Schinzel, R; Balla, G; Balla, J; Heidland, A; Nagy, J
- Abstract
Approximately 20-50% of IgA nephropathy patients develop end-stage renal disease. We have previously found enhanced oxidative stress and decreased antioxidant capacity in red blood cells of IgA nephropathy patients. In this study we assess oxidative stress, non-enzymatic glycation, oxidative resistance of low-density lipoprotein and its alpha-tocopherol content in these patients.
